Note

Duplicated sequence clips have the original sequence clip name with a
sequential number appended to the end. For example, If Sequence6 is dupli-
cated, the duplicate’s name will be “Sequence6-(X)” where (X) is the next
available sequential number.

Undo/Redo Operations

Undo an Operation

To undo a previously-performed operation and return to the prior state, do
any of the following:

Click the

Undo

button (highlighted in blue in

Figure 442

) on the Time-

line.

Figure 442. Timeline Undo Button

Click the list button [V] on the

Undo

button and select a specific opera-

tion to undo from the menu.

Note

The number of undo operations is not limited. However, if memory is low,
undo histories may be deleted beginning with the oldest.

Select Edit>Undo from the Preview window menu bar.

Press the [

CTRL

]+[

Z

] keys on the keyboard.
